Swara Bhasker speaks out on additional CRPF deployment amid CJP protest

Swara Bhasker criticized the Indian government for deploying additional CRPF companies in Delhi amid student protests against Union Education Minister Dharmendra Pradhan over the NEET paper leak controversy.
She said the government called 20 additional CRPF companies to Delhi and reportedly 10 more from Kashmir, calling it a declaration of war on the youth.
Students have been peacefully protesting with demands for the minister's resignation, and Bhasker argued they should not be treated as more dangerous than external threats.
The additional CRPF deployment was confirmed by PTI as part of security measures in Delhi.
Actor Anupam Kher also commented, warning students to be cautious of political parties using the movement for their own agendas.
